What is purpose of using circuit breakers in double bus bar bus bar arrangement?

It permits breaker maintenance without interruption of power which is not possible in a double bus system, but it provides all the advantages of the double bus system. It, however, requires one additional isolator (bypass isolator) for each feeder circuit and introduces slight complication in system layout.

What is the purpose of a bus tie breaker?

A tie breaker connects both main buses and is normally closed, allowing for more flexibility in operation. A fault on one bus requires isolation of the bus while the circuits are fed from the opposite bus.

What is the purpose of a bus bar?

Busbars, also known as busbar trunking systems, distribute electricity with greater ease and flexibility than some other more permanent forms of installation and distribution. Sometimes spelled bus bar or buss bar, they are often metallic strips of copper, brass, or aluminum that both ground and conduct electricity.

What is bus coupler and bus riser?

A bus coupler is a cubicle containing some method of splitting the horizontal busbars in two, for flexibility of distribution or for. A bus riser is a cubicle designed to receive incoming cables from below and connect them to horizontal bus bars between adjacent cubicles in a run of switchgear.

What is the difference between bus section and bus coupler?

The bus sectionalizer is used in switchgear having a Single Busbar Configuration to divide the bus into two Sections; while bus coupler is normally used in switchgear having Double Busbar Configuration to Connect the Two buses in case of load transfer, contingencies, etc.

What is bus bar protection?

Busbar protection is a protection scheme meant to protect the busbar from electrical fault. The main purpose of this busbar is to increase the reliability of power system by maintain the evacuation of power in case of tripping of any feeder due to fault.

What is the use of bus coupler?

Bus coupler is a device which is used to couple one bus to the other without any interruption in power supply and without creating hazardous arcs. Bus coupler is a breaker used to couple two busbars in order to perform maintenance on other circuit breakers associated with that busbar.

What is double breaker double bus?

3.3 Double Bus–Double Breaker Arrangement The double bus–double breaker arrangement involves two breakers and two buses for each circuit (Figure 3.2). With two breakers and two buses per circuit, a single bus failure can be isolated without interrupting any circuits or loads.

What is bus electrical?

Busbars, thick conductors used in electrical substations. In power engineering, a “bus” is any graph node of the single-line diagram at which voltage, current, power flow, or other quantities are to be evaluated. This may correspond to the physical busbars in substation.

What is bus duct in electrical?

Bus duct is used in commercial and industrial settings to conduct electricity to power cables or cable bus. Structurally, a bus duct is a sheet metal duct containing either aluminum or copper busbars (metallic strips or bars that conduct a substantial electrical current) in a grounded metal enclosure.

What is bus riser in switchgear?

Bus riser is a set of bus bar that connected from the coupler breakers, outgoing section enclose in the panel and connected to your incoming 1 or incoming 2 bus bar section. It depend which side is your outgoing from the bus bar coupler breakers or depend on your electrical design.

What is double bus system?

The double bus–single breaker arrangement connects each circuit to two buses, and there is a tie breaker between the buses. With the tie breaker operated normally closed, it allows each circuit to be supplied from either bus via its switches. Thus providing increased operating flexibility and improved reliability.

What is the use of bus coupler breaker in double bus system?

The main purpose of Bus Coupler Breaker in Double Bus Single Breaker Scheme, is to connect Bus-I and Bus-II so that power transfer from the two buses can take place to the connected feeders. In case of fault in any bus bar, bus coupler breaker along with connected feeder breakers trips.

What is a double bus bar system?

In double bus bar system two identical bus bars are used in such a way that any outgoing or incoming feeder can be taken from any of the bus. Actually every feeder is connected to both of the buses in parallel through individual isolator as shown in the figure.
